EmfPolyBezierTo

Inheritance: java.lang.Object, com.aspose.imaging.fileformats.emf.MetaObject, com.aspose.imaging.fileformats.emf.emf.records.EmfRecord, com.aspose.imaging.fileformats.emf.emf.records.EmfDrawingRecordType, com.aspose.imaging.fileformats.emf.emf.records.EmfBoundedRecord, com.aspose.imaging.fileformats.emf.emf.records.EmfPolyShape

public final class EmfPolyBezierTo extends EmfPolyShape

EMR_POLYBEZIERTO‑posten specificerar en eller flera Bézierkurvor baserade på den aktuella positionen.

Kubiska Bezier-kurvor definieras med hjälp av ändpunkterna och kontrollpunkterna som anges i aPoints‑fältet. Den första kurvan ritas från den första punkten till den fjärde punkten, med den andra och tredje punkten som kontrollpunkter. Varje efterföljande kurva i sekvensen kräver exakt tre ytterligare punkter: slutpunkten för den föregående kurvan används som startpunkt, de två nästa punkterna i sekvensen är kontrollpunkter, och den tredje är slutpunkten. De kubiska Bezier‑kurvorna SKALL ritas med den aktuella pennan

Konstruktörer

KonstruktorBeskrivning
EmfPolyBezierTo(EmfRecord source)Initierar en ny instans av klassen EmfPolyBezierTo.
EmfPolyBezierTo()Initierar en ny instans av klassen EmfPolyBezierTo.

EmfPolyBezierTo(EmfRecord source)

public EmfPolyBezierTo(EmfRecord source)

Initierar en ny instans av klassen EmfPolyBezierTo.

Parameters:

ParameterTypBeskrivning
sourceEmfRecordKällan.

EmfPolyBezierTo()

public EmfPolyBezierTo()

Initierar en ny instans av klassen EmfPolyBezierTo.